Sink repair services involve diagnosing and fixing issues related to kitchen and bathroom sinks to restore proper function and prevent further damage. These services typically address problems such as leaks, clogs, damaged or corroded pipes, and faulty fixtures. Skilled contractors can identify the root cause of the issue, whether it’s a broken seal, a cracked basin, or a malfunctioning drain assembly, and then perform the necessary repairs to ensure the sink operates smoothly again. Proper sink repair not only improves the appearance of the fixture but also helps avoid more costly repairs down the line caused by water damage or persistent drainage problems.
Common problems that lead homeowners to seek sink repair include persistent leaks, slow draining, foul odors, or visible cracks and corrosion. Leaking sinks can cause water waste and increase utility bills, while drainage issues may result in standing water or backups that hinder daily routines. Cracks or chips in the sink basin can compromise the fixture’s integrity and lead to leaks or further damage if not addressed promptly. The overview below groups typical Sink Repair proj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- Typical costs for minor sink repairs, such as fixing leaks or replacing a faucet, usually range from $150 to $400. Many routine jobs fall within this middle range, though prices can vary based on the specific issue and parts needed.
Moderate Repairs - More involved repairs like replacing a sink trap or addressing moderate pipe issues generally cost between $400 and $1,000. These projects are common and tend to be on the higher end of the typical repair spectrum.
Full Sink Replacement - Replacing an entire sink setup often ranges from $600 to $2,500 depending on the sink type and installation complexity. Many local contractors handle these projects within this range, with larger or custom installations reaching higher costs.
Complete Faucet and Fixture Replacement - Upgrading fixtures or installing new faucets typically costs between $200 and $800. This is a common upgrade, with most projects falling into this range, though premium fixtures can increase the price.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What are common signs that a sink needs repair? Signs include slow draining, persistent clogs, leaks under the sink, or foul odors emanating from the drain area.
Can a damaged sink be repaired without replacement? Many issues such as leaks, cracks, or broken fixtures can often be repaired by experienced local contractors without needing a full replacement.
What types of sink repairs do local service providers handle? They typically handle fixing leaks, unclogging drains, repairing or replacing damaged fixtures, and sealing cracks or chips in the sink surface.
Is it possible to prevent future sink problems? Regular maintenance like avoiding pouring grease down the drain and promptly addressing minor leaks can help prevent more serious issues.
How do local contractors determine if a sink needs repair or replacement? They assess the extent of damage, functionality, and condition of the sink to recommend the most practical repair or replacement options.
